In this segment, Jim
takes 2-3 callers
and asks them to
submit five stocks
that make up their
largest positions in
their portfolio.
He then comments on
whether or not they
are properly
diversified.
Jim:
Told you I was
serious about the
diversification
game… it is hard to
make accurate
predictions about
this market… and
this market, it
feels down right
impossible
sometimes… that is
why I have made it
my personnel mission
to trumpet the
merits of
diversification
throughout the land…
so it came to pass
on Wednesday’s we
play Am I
Diversified?…
This is a chance to
get your portfolio
in shape… what you
have to do is you
have to call me…
announce your five
stocks… and then ask
me, Am I
Diversified?...

Caller:
Okay I have five
stocks here, I have
been chasing them
all the way down -
Deere (DE),
PPL Corporation (PPL),
Altria (MO*),
General Electric (GE),
Bristol-Myers
(BMY*)?
Jim:
Let’s take a look at
this… we have got an
interesting grouping
here… we’ve got a
bunch of these
stocks that I own
for
my charitable trust,
ActionAlertsPlus.com
you can follow
along… I send out
emails saying that I
wish this Altria - I
wish it would go to
$20... but it has
got a great yield…
that is a tobacco
company… that is the
old Phillip-Morris
they split into two…
Philip Morris International
(PM)
is the
international, this
(Altria (MO*)
is the domestic… it
has got a great
yield… Bristol-Myers
I own that one for
the trust… this is
got another
fantastic yield… it
is a great drug
company… it has got
a lot of great
cancer drugs… PPL is
probably a local
company for my
friend here… because
this is Pennsylvania
Power and Light… it
is a well run
company… General
Electric, it is
parent company to
this network… I work
for it… I own it for
my trust… you could
argue that it has
been a terrible
stock… I work for
it, okay… and John
Deere is a company
that is deeply
related to
agriculture… much
less to
infrastructure, but
it trades with the
infrastructure
names… what do we
have… we have an
agricultural stock,
a big industrial, a
utility, a tobacco,
and a drug company…
Ed has got it
exactly right…I
salute him.. .that
is perfect
diversification…
that is exactly what
we are looking for.
Verdict:
YES,
Diversified.

Caller:
My five stocks are -
Consolidated Edison
(ED),
Merck (MRK),
Wal-Mart (WMT*),
McDonald's
(MCD),
and
Research
In Motion (RIMM).
Tell me, Jim, am I
diversified?
Jim:
Alright, talk about
a hot button
portfolio… RIMM we
know I like it… did
I tell you to take
profits… I mean I
told some people to
take profits… I
obviously didn’t
make a big stink
about it… that was
bad… this is a tech
company… and I still
believe in it, it is
up 20% for the year…
Merck is a great
yielding drug
company… I think it
is getting it’s act
together… Wal-Mart I
own it for
my charitable trust,
ActionAlertsPlus.com,
it is the finest
retailer in the
land… once again we
salute Lee Scott,
the former CEO… Con
Ed, safest, bumped
the dividend, it has
got a nice yield… it
has got a 5.87%
yield, that is
pretty good…
utilities were
slower today…
McDonald’s got a 3%
yield plus Jim
Skinner, everyone
knows McDonalds, I
salute the company,
I am trying to buy
it for
my charitable trust…
alright what do we
got here…. we got a
food company, you
know a food
retailer… we got a
tech… we got a drug
company… we got a
retailer… I am not
linking food retail
with store retail,
they are very
different… and we
have a utility… that
is again perfect
diversification…
some would quibble
and say Jim, these
are both consumer
spend plays
McDonalds and
Wal-Mart… that would
be wrong… Wal-Mart
is a big retailer,
and McDonalds is
fast food… I like
these two players…
they both get the
gold medal… and I am
not talking about
the flour.
Verdict:
YES,
Diversified.
